func (*NodeBlockMaker) VerifyBlock ¶
func (n *NodeBlockMaker) VerifyBlock(block *structures.Block, flags int) error
Verify the block. We check if it is correct agains previous block Verify a block against blockchain RULES
- Verification is done agains blockchain branch starting from prevblock, not current top branch
- There can be only 1 transaction make reward per block
- number of transactions must be in correct ranges (reward transaction is not calculated)
- transactions can have as input other transaction from this block and it must be listed BEFORE (output must be before input in same block)
- all inputs must be in blockchain (correct unspent inputs)
- Additionally verify each transaction agains signatures, total amount, balance etc
- Verify hash is correc agains rules

type QueryFromProxyResult ¶
type QueryFromProxyResult struct { Status uint8 TX *structures.Transaction TXData []byte StringToSign []byte ReplaceQuery string ErrorCode uint16 Error error }
The structure to return information on new query request from proxy This includes a status , data to sign (if needed), new transaction (if was created) The structure can include error, so no need to have error response separately
